The density changes when the molten resin solidifies. When the molten resin solidifies, the volume usually decreases compared to the molten state. If the entire product shrinks evenly at a constant rate, the molded product will simply become smaller, maintaining a similar shape. However, if the shrinkage varies in different parts, the molded product will deform and change shape, making it impossible to achieve the desired shape just by adjusting the dimensions of the mold. The deformation of the product is believed to be caused not by some external force acting on it, but by the distribution of partial strains leading to overall deformation. This way of thinking is used as a phenomenon model in the calculations for shrinkage warpage analysis in injection molding CAE (Computer Aided Engineering). *For more details, please refer to the related links or feel free to contact us.*
